    Learning to walk is a natural process, and families don't have to intervene too much. Most children start walking at 10-18 months, but before that, children have to experience and learn to roll over, sit alone, crawl, stand, walk and other major motor development, and only by mastering these "skills" can they lay a solid foundation for walking. The child learns to sit alone at around 6 months, this is to exercise the lower back muscles so that they can walk later; At 7 to 11 months of age, parents can try an abdominal crawl, which will strengthen the arms and legs.

    At the age of 7-8 months, children have basically learned to stand. At this time, if the child is leaning against the wall or table, the child will consciously move his feet and walk slowly. Children will encounter failures at every stage of development, parents should not forcibly intervene, and at the same time encourage children, they can appropriately carry out correct guidance.

    How about using a walker to help you learn to walk? I believe that many parents know the answer to this question, Walker has long been on the "blacklist". According to the characteristics of children's development, their heads are heavier, and the child's self-regulation and balance ability is not very good.

    If you roll over in a walker, your child is likely to fall headfirst to the ground. This is not an exaggeration, there is a real situation in life. If a family member must give their child a walker, stay with them and **.

    When a child uses a walker, the body is actually supported by the walker, so the child's legs are not well exercised. The hood of the walker is narrow in the front and wide in the back, so that the children sit on it with their legs apart in the middle. Over time, the child is likely to develop O-shaped legs, which seriously affects the child's walking posture and the normal development of the legs.
